Heim > Backend-Entwicklung > PHP-Tutorial > 如何将一个文本框的内容传到新页面中的文本框

如何将一个文本框的内容传到新页面中的文本框

WBOY
Freigeben: 2016-06-23 14:39:51
Original
1835 Leute haben es durchsucht




如这样 第一张图的内容点击提交后 内容自动显示在第二张图文本框内

之前写的是通过pathinfo的形式
onclick="javascript:window.location.href = 'aa.com/xxx/?title=' + document.getElementById('askfdk_da_mob').value

 value='

但是这种方法被其他功能占用了 

想问下用JS要怎么写呢?

是两个不同的页面 不是同一个页面


回复讨论(解决方案)

var function = buttonclick(){    var title = $("#askfdk_da_mob").val();    url = "aa.com/xxx";    url += "title="+title+"";    location.hreg =  url;}value='<?php echo $_GET['title'] ?>
Nach dem Login kopieren

手误 location.href = url;

手误 location.href = url;
因为另外一个要接收的页面value已经占用了 所以有其他的方法吗

value='
value='

获取值 ,是根据location.href传递过来的参数来定,获取不同参数,就获取不同值。

1、第二张图片里加一个隐藏域,用来接收post过来的内容;
2、js获取这个隐藏域的内容并赋值给第二张图片里的文本域中

主要code如下:

if(isset($_POST['note'])){	$note=$_POST['note'];	echo "<input type='hidden' value='$note' id='content' />";}	
Nach dem Login kopieren

<form method="post"><textarea id="note_reply"></textarea><input type="submit" value="post" /></form>
Nach dem Login kopieren


document.getElementById('note_reply').value=document.getElementById('content').value;
Nach dem Login kopieren

第一个页面的提交使用POST方法,在第二个页面中用$_POST[]获取一下传给一个变量不就可以了吗?

第一个页面的HTML代码

<form action="第二个页面" method="post">内容:<input type="text" name="question" /><input type="submit" name="sub" /></form>
Nach dem Login kopieren

第二个页面的PHP代码
$question = $_POST["question"];
Nach dem Login kopieren

第二个页面的HTML代码,嵌套php代码
<input type="text" name="question" value="<?php echo $question; ?>">
Nach dem Login kopieren

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age